How to Connect Azure SQL Database to Power BI
Connecting Azure SQL Database with Power BI Desktop is straightforward.
Step 1: Open Power BI Desktop
Open Power BI Desktop and go to the Home tab.
Select Get Data to view the available data sources.
Step 2: Select Azure SQL Database
From the available connectors, select Azure SQL Database.
Power BI will open a connection window where you can provide your database details.
Step 3: Enter Your Database Details
Enter the required Azure SQL Database information, such as the server and database name.
You will then be asked to authenticate your connection using the appropriate credentials.
Step 4: Select Your Data
After connecting successfully, Power BI displays the available tables and data.
Select the tables you need for your report and load them into Power BI Desktop.
You can also transform, shape, or merge your data before creating the report.
